Here are some things you should check right now. WebTo edit the privacy settings for your photos: Click your profile picture in the top right of Facebook. Click Photos, then click Your Photos. Click the photo you want to change the privacy settings for. Click in the top right. Click Edit post audience. Select the audience you want to share the photo with. WebOpen the Settings app. Go to the “Privacy & Security” page. Click on “General.” Turn off the “Let apps show me personalized ads by using my Advertising ID” option.
